  2. It just seems crazy. I went into refereeing because the grass roots football was suffering not having enough not club referees, and the youth game was suffering. I do have to say there are far to many games that are so one sided. As a referee it becomes very hard to stay focused on the game, and I would much prefer to have two evenly matched teams. There has to be a way that they can match the teams up better than they do, as out of over 30 games last season only 2 were won by less than one goal. The development of our players is suffering, and I just feel so sorry for the team getting stuffed. I also have to stick 100% to the rules and play the full amount of time, unless I stopped the match after 20 minutes at 0-6 and got the agreement that we play 25 minutes each way. I also had to give a pen for a clear handball.

  5. I am a qualified hertfordshire referee, and today I refereed a County cup 1st round game. I am not sure what the gap between the 2 teams was, but the final score was Melbourn Under 14's 0 St Albans under 14's 20. I just do not understand why in the 1st round and the first lot of games of the new season they would put young lads with such a wide gulf in ability on the same pitch. Why not have the first round where they have the same league level playing each other, just so they can gaina little bit of confidence. What good does this do for the development of our young players and keeping them interested in playing? Yes of course they will have to play the higher teams in the end, but they should have seedings at grass roots football. I found myself trying to delay the restart of the game after each goal, just so they did not score so many. The winning team goalkeeper touched the ball twice in the whole game, so how does it help his game and the defenders around him?
